Boys’ HS Previews: Delaware’s Archmere Academy, Delaware Military Academy

March 16, 2025 by Chris Goldberg

Phillylacrosse.com, Posted 3/16/25
One of a series of scholastic previews for the 2025 season

Archmere Academy
League: Diamond State Athletic Conference
Head Coach: Pete Duncan (11 years at Archmere 133-42 record, 20 years as Head Coach 240-103 overall)
Assistant Coaches: Darren Mahoney, Jason Molnar, Ethan Kates, Connor Smeader
2024 Record: 13-5
2024 Team Honors: Diamond State Athletic Conference Champions, State Semifinalists
Opener: March 24, Home vs. Newark Charter School, 4:00 pm
Key returners: Aidan Mahoney ’25 midfield, Jack Chesman ’25 defense, David Pinto ’25 attack, Zidane Breña ’26 goalie, Ryan Hagenberg ’26 midfield, Jonah Kuzinski ’26 midfield
Key newcomers: Noah Blessington ’26 defense, Cole Rafter ’27, attack, Jack Shahan ’27 defense, Jack King ’28 midfield, Larry Formosa ’26 attack, Quin Duncan ’28 attack, Henry Hahn ’26 defense, Tiernan Matthews ’26 midfield, Wyatt Beekley ’28 midfield, Owen Kates ’27 midfield, Lucas Passehl ’28 attack, Ethan Beach ’26 midfield, Mason Kohl ’26 LSM, Luca Anerino ’26 defense
Coach’s Outlook for 2025: “Our team has the pieces to maintain a standard of success established by years of strong player leadership and commitment to the Archmere program. While our team will be relatively young, we do return a core group of upperclassmen with vital experience ready to lead us. Our schedule out-of-conference is still among the strongest in Delaware, and we will aim to get better as the season progresses.”

Delaware Military Academy Seahawks
League: Diamond State
Head Coach: Tyler Morrell (2nd year as HC)
Assistants: John Lunsford
John Beachell
Jack Gerber
Andrew Papanicolas
Jon Smith
Jerry Kryspin III
2024 record: 5 wins, 10 losses
Opener: March 25th @ First State Military Academy
Key Returners: Cole Rice, Erik Mischel, Logan Beachell, Davey Cresswell, Eric Pennington
Key Newcomers: Jed Olkkola
Coach’s outlook: “We are extremely optimistic for the season ahead of us. We have built a brand new culture of Lacrosse at the school. We are in the business of building lacrosse players, not importing them.”
